Abstract

A new criterion for identifying generalized diagonally dominant matrices (GDDM, or HH-matrices) was given in [K. Ojiro, H. Niki, M. Usui, A note on a new criterion for the HH-matrix property, J. Comput. Appl. Math. 150 (2003) 293–302], where the criterion is effective when the given matrix is irreducible. However, when the matrix is reducible, it may lead to a false answer. In this work, to overcome this drawback, we present an improved version. The new method is always convergent and needs fewer iterations than the earlier one. An interesting sufficient and necessary condition for any weakly diagonally dominant matrix (WDDM) to be an HH-matrix is obtained. Finally, some numerical examples for the effectiveness of the proposed algorithm are presented.
